Judicial Criticism and Rebuke

  • ⚖️ President Trump continues to criticize federal judges, even after a rare public statement from Chief Justice John Roberts.
  • 💡 Roberts rebuked Trump's call for the impeachment of a federal judge, stating that impeachment is not an appropriate response to disagreeing with a judicial decision.
  • 🗣️ Trump expressed his view that there are "bad judges" and questioned what to do with "rogue judges" who rule unfavorably.

Separation of Powers and Rule of Law

  • 🏛️ The Chief Justice's statement highlights an inflection point where the executive branch is perceived to be openly defying judicial orders.
  • ⚠️ The separation of powers is intended to allow for conflict between branches, but the executive is expected to follow judicial orders.
  • 📉 There is a concern that if the President disregards rulings from lower courts, he may eventually disregard rulings from the Supreme Court.

Legal Case Dynamics

  • 📄 A federal judge ruled that actions by Elon Musk and Doge likely violated the Constitution by closing an agency created by Congress, in response to a lawsuit by fired employees.
  • ⚖️ In a separate case, a judge ordered a case against Mahmud Khalil to be transferred to New Jersey, ruling that a habeas petition should be filed where the person is detained.
  • 📍 The transfer to New Jersey is seen as a win for Khalil, though the government had sought to have the case dismissed and transferred to Louisiana, a more conservative judicial district.
  • 🏛️ The judge declined to dismiss the case, citing Supreme Court precedent on where habeas petitions should be filed.
